解密离线翻译工具:如何突破网络限制实现安全高效的跨语言沟通
在全球化交流日益频繁的今天,语言障碍依然是阻碍高效沟通的重要因素。传统在线翻译工具依赖网络连接,在网络不稳定或敏感环境下难以保障沟通的连续性和数据安全性。离线翻译工具的出现,为解决这一痛点提供了全新方案。本文将深度解析开源离线翻译工具RTranslator的核心优势、安全架构及实操指南,帮助用户充分利用本地化技术实现跨语言无障碍沟通。
如何解决传统翻译工具的三大核心痛点
痛点一:网络依赖导致沟通中断
在国际商务差旅、偏远地区旅行或网络管制环境中,在线翻译工具常因网络问题无法使用。RTranslator采用全本地化处理架构,所有翻译任务均在设备端完成,彻底摆脱网络依赖。实测数据显示,在无网络环境下,RTranslator响应速度比在线工具快3-5倍,平均翻译延迟控制在0.5秒以内。
痛点二:数据隐私泄露风险
传统翻译工具将用户输入内容上传至云端处理,存在商业机密或个人隐私泄露风险。RTranslator的安全架构确保所有语音和文本数据全程在本地加密处理,核心代码实现于app/src/main/cpp/src/目录下,从技术层面杜绝数据外泄可能。
痛点三:多设备协作效率低下
跨国会议场景中,参会者使用不同翻译工具常导致沟通不同步。RTranslator的多设备蓝牙互联功能支持实时对话翻译,最多可同时连接8台设备,实现多方实时翻译。
如何理解离线翻译工具的核心优势
本地化模型处理技术
RTranslator采用先进的本地神经网络模型,将翻译引擎完全部署在用户设备上。模型文件存储于app/src/main/assets/目录,首次配置后即可离线运行,翻译准确率达到专业级水平,支持英语、意大利语、西班牙语等20余种语言组合。
模块化资源管理系统
为解决移动端存储空间限制,项目采用创新的模块化设计:
- 主应用包体积控制在200MB以内
- 翻译模型作为独立资源包提供,用户可按需下载
- 支持增量更新,模型更新仅需下载差异部分,节省90%流量消耗
多场景适配的交互设计
RTranslator针对不同使用场景优化了交互流程:
- 对话模式:支持多设备实时语音互译,适合商务会议
- 对讲机模式:单设备双向翻译,满足旅行交流需求
- 文本模式:精准翻译文档内容,辅助学术研究
如何从零开始配置RTranslator
环境准备与安装步骤
-
确保Android设备满足以下条件:
- 系统版本Android 8.0及以上
- 至少3GB可用存储空间
- 支持蓝牙4.0及以上
-
获取应用源码并构建:
git clone https://gitcode.com/GitHub_Trending/rt/RTranslator cd RTranslator ./gradlew assembleDebug -
安装并启动应用,首次运行时按提示下载所需语言模型
核心功能配置指南
-
语言偏好设置:
- 进入设置界面(app/src/main/java/nie/translator/rtranslator/settings/SettingsActivity.java)
- 选择常用语言组合,系统会优先加载对应模型
- 启用"自动语言检测"以适应多语言混合场景
-
蓝牙设备配对:
- 在对话模式下点击"Connection"按钮
- 待配对设备开启RTranslator并进入同一模式
- 搜索并选择目标设备,完成配对后即可开始实时翻译
-
性能优化配置:
- 在设置中调整"翻译质量"参数平衡速度与准确性
- 启用"模型缓存"功能减少重复加载时间
- 根据设备性能选择合适的语音识别灵敏度
如何在三大典型场景中高效使用离线翻译
国际商务会议场景
痛点:跨国团队会议依赖专业翻译人员,成本高且存在信息延迟。
解决方案:使用RTranslator的多设备对话模式,所有参会者连接至同一蓝牙网络,实时翻译发言内容。
操作步骤:
- 会议组织者创建蓝牙网络并设置会议语言
- 参会者加入网络并选择各自的母语
- 发言时按下麦克风按钮,系统自动识别并翻译
- 翻译内容实时显示在所有设备上,支持文字回放
海外旅行场景
痛点:异国旅行中网络不稳定,无法及时获取翻译支持。
解决方案:启用对讲机模式,单人即可完成双向翻译,特别适合问路、购物等日常交流。
使用技巧:
- 预先下载目的地语言模型
- 在嘈杂环境中降低麦克风灵敏度
- 使用"常用短语"功能快速调用预设表达
- 配合蓝牙耳机实现 hands-free 操作
学术研究场景
痛点:阅读外文文献时需要频繁翻译专业术语,在线翻译效率低。
解决方案:利用文本翻译模式,批量处理文献内容,保持专业术语一致性。
高级功能:
- 使用"术语库"功能自定义专业词汇翻译
- 支持PDF文档导入(app/src/main/java/nie/translator/rtranslator/tools/FileTools.java)
- 翻译结果可导出为TXT/PDF格式
- 启用"离线词典"功能获取词义详解
如何保障离线翻译工具的安全与隐私
本地数据处理架构解析
RTranslator采用端到端本地化架构,所有翻译任务在设备本地完成:
- 语音识别模块:app/src/main/java/nie/translator/rtranslator/voice_translation/neural_networks/voice/Recognizer.java
- 文本翻译引擎:app/src/main/cpp/src/translator.cc
- 数据存储:仅在本地沙盒保存用户偏好设置,不收集任何个人数据
安全增强配置建议
- 定期更新应用获取安全补丁
- 启用"应用锁"功能防止未授权访问
- 翻译完成后手动清除会话记录
- 仅从官方渠道下载语言模型
如何优化离线翻译工具的性能与体验
设备适配与资源管理
- 根据设备CPU核心数调整并行翻译线程数
- 对不常用语言模型进行归档以释放存储空间
- 定期清理模型缓存文件
- 在低电量模式下自动降低翻译质量换取更长使用时间
高级使用技巧
- 通过"快捷手势"功能快速切换翻译模式
- 自定义界面布局适应不同使用习惯
- 使用"翻译历史"功能回顾之前的翻译内容
- 配置"自动标点"功能提升文本可读性
RTranslator作为开源离线翻译工具的代表,通过创新的本地化技术和用户友好的设计,为跨语言沟通提供了安全、高效的解决方案。无论是商务交流、海外旅行还是学术研究,这款工具都能帮助用户突破网络限制和语言障碍,实现真正的无障碍沟通。随着本地化AI技术的不断发展,离线翻译工具必将成为全球化时代的必备应用。
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ust0101-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
MiMo-V2.5-ProMiMo-V2.5-Pro作为旗舰模型,擅⻓处理复杂Agent任务,单次任务可完成近千次⼯具调⽤与⼗余轮上 下⽂压缩。Python00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
Kimi-K2.6Kimi K2.6 是一款开源的原生多模态智能体模型,在长程编码、编码驱动设计、主动自主执行以及群体任务编排等实用能力方面实现了显著提升。Python00
MiniMax-M2.7MiniMax-M2.7 是我们首个深度参与自身进化过程的模型。M2.7 具备构建复杂智能体应用框架的能力,能够借助智能体团队、复杂技能以及动态工具搜索,完成高度精细的生产力任务。Python00

